Ry Cooder will forever be a hero to me for saving the first Captain Beefheart album:
He quickly made his exit...Don Van Vliet was a bit much for him... Safe as Milk was released in 1967, less than two years later The Magic Band emerged from months of cloistered work and starvation with the landmark Trout Mask Replica:
All composed on piano by Van Vliet, who had never played before, and somehow transcribed into notation by drummer John French and arranged for the band. Too cool for school, man .

The lyrics are from the Solomon Islands (small islands north of Australia).
(Baegu)
Sasi sasi ae ko taro taro amu
Ko agi agi boroi tika oli oe lau
Tika gwao oe lau koro inomaena
I dai tabesau I tebetai nau mouri
Tabe ta wane initoa te ai rofia
Sasi sasi ae kwa dao mata ole
Rowelae e lea kwa dao mata biru
I dai tabesau I tebetai nau mouri
Sasi sasi ae ko taro taro amu
Ko agi agi boroi tika oli oe lau
Tika gwao oe lau koro inomaena
I dai tabesau I tebetai nau mouri
Little brother, little brother, stop crying, stop crying
Though you are crying and crying, who else will carry you
Who else will groom you, both of us are now orphans
From the island of the dead, their spirit will continue to look after us
Just like royalty, taken care of with all the wisdom of such a place
Little brother, little brother even in the gardens
This lullaby continues to the different divisions of the garden,
From the island of the dead, their spirit will continue to look after us
Little brother, little brother, stop crying, stop crying
Though you are crying and crying, who else will carry you
Who else will groom you, both of us are now orphans
From the island of the dead, their spirit will continue to look after us
